Natalie Chandler (North Thames GLH)

I don't know

Amber on UK fanconi panel. Green review on radial dysplasia case (from Aus). Green on all relevant Aus panels including fetal. Two cases in literature. 3rd paper refers to case in 2nd paper. Should go green on fanconi panels first.

Amber on Fanconi anaemia panel. Review 2019 - No new literature that I can find. Just two families reported. Suggest keeping amber - fanconi panel should go green first.
